Details: In this position you will provide direct care, support and guidance to children ages 4-17 with physical and developmental disabilities, mental health disorders and some complex behaviours. Responsibilities will include aspects of case management, fostering community relationships and utilizing a variety of evidence based strategies to help families develop skills and manage their children’s behavior, care and safety.
